GitHub for Atom features and specs

  • Seamless GitHub Integration
    Atom by GitHub provides seamless integration with GitHub, allowing users to easily manage repositories, perform version control operations, and collaborate on projects directly from the editor.
  • Customization
    Atom is highly customizable, allowing developers to tailor the editor to their preferences with themes, color schemes, and packages that enhance functionality and user experience.
  • Open-Source
    As an open-source editor, Atom encourages community contributions, offering a vast library of plugins and packages developed by other users to extend its capabilities.
  • Cross-Platform
    Atom is available on multiple operating systems, including Windows, macOS, and Linux, ensuring a consistent development experience across different environments.
  • Teletype for Collaboration
    The Teletype package allows for real-time collaboration within Atom, enabling users to share their workspace with others and work together seamlessly.

Possible disadvantages of GitHub for Atom

  • Performance
    Atom can be resource-intensive, particularly with large projects or numerous extensions installed, which may impact performance and speed negatively.
  • End of Active Development
    GitHub announced the sunsetting of Atom effective December 2022, which means there will be no new features or active development moving forward, potentially affecting long-term usability.
  • Complexity for Beginners
    The level of customization and plethora of features can be overwhelming to new users or those unfamiliar with configuring development environments.
  • Competition
    With other powerful editors like Visual Studio Code gaining popularity due to better performance and active development, Atom faces strong competition in the market.

Kaneva features and specs

  • Community
    Kaneva offers a virtual space where users can interact and connect with a diverse and active community. This social aspect encourages collaboration and engagement.
  • Creativity
    The platform allows users to express themselves creatively through custom avatars and virtual environments, appealing to those interested in design and personal expression.
  • Shopping and Economy
    Kaneva incorporates a virtual economy where users can buy, sell, and trade items, creating an engaging experience for those interested in virtual commerce.
  • Multiple Activities
    It provides a variety of activities and games, catering to a broad range of interests and offering entertainment and engagement to users.

Possible disadvantages of Kaneva

  • Technical Limitations
    Like many virtual worlds, Kaneva may suffer from technical issues such as lag, crashes, or outdated graphics, affecting user experience.
  • Niche Audience
    While it offers unique experiences, its appeal might be limited to a niche audience, potentially reducing its user base over time.
  • Monetization
    The emphasis on in-game commerce could lead to a pay-to-win scenario or create barriers for users who do not wish to spend real money.
  • Platform Competition
    Kaneva faces competition from more well-known and established virtual platforms which may have larger user bases and more resources for development.
